Sign Up for Publishers by Appointment at Winter Institute
- By Liz Button
The new Publishers by Appointment programming initiative at Winter Institute 2020 in Baltimore will allow booksellers to sign up for 15-minute slots to meet with participating publishers of their choice. This new program will take place on Tuesday, January 21, 9:30 a.m. to 4:15 p.m.
Booksellers can sign up now to book an appointment with one of the 19 publishing companies that have signed on to take part. Currently the list of participating publishers is as follows:

Andrew Pineda of 27th Letter Books in Detroit, Michigan, told BTW that the 2020 Winter Institute in Baltimore will be the store’s first, so he and his colleagues are really looking forward to a week of connection and community within the bookselling industry, including an appointment with publisher Akashic Books.
“We're excited for Publishers by Appointment because it lets us prioritize making a personal connection with publishers that we admire,” said Pineda. “We can imagine that the time to make those connections could easily slip amidst all of the activity: the trade show, education sessions, the impromptu meetings. However, the appointment times give us peace of mind knowing that we've got time set aside. As a store, we have admired the works Akashic has put out, as well as their aesthetic/mission: 'reverse gentrification of the literary world.’ As a bookstore, we're drawn to publishers and other businesses that are assured in their roles as they share stories.”
